The Asthma Score in 43724, Caldwell, Ohio is 2 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.
89.51 percent of the population in 43724 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 62.65 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 5.14 percent of the residents in 43724 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.83 members with about 2.33 cars available per household.
An estimate of 71.79 percent of the residents in 43724 has some form of health insurance. 41.16 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 45.77 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 43724 would have to travel an average of 21.03 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Southeastern Ohio Regional Medical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 43724, Caldwell, Ohio.

As of , an estimate of 9,188 residents live in 43724 with a median age of 48.9 years. 15.80 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 24.60 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 27.53 percent of the residents in 43724 is currently married, and 37.95 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 43724 is $5,161.00.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 43724 is approximately $562. The median household spends about 10.89 percent of their income on housing.

Asthma is a chronic respiratory condition that affects millions of people worldwide. It causes inflammation and narrowing of the airways, leading to symptoms such as wheezing, shortness of breath, chest tightness, and coughing. Managing asthma requires regular medical care, including check-ups with healthcare providers and access to prescription medications.
